Details are below. */ PETSC_INTERN PetscErrorCode SNESNoise_dnest_(PetscInt *, PetscScalar *, PetscScalar *, PetscScalar *, PetscScalar *, PetscScalar *, PetscInt *, PetscScalar *); PetscErrorCode SNESNoise_dnest_(PetscInt *nf, double *fval, double *h__, double *fnoise, double *fder2, double *hopt, PetscInt *info, double *eps) { /* Initialized data */ static double const__[15] = {.71, .41, .23, .12, .063, .033, .018, .0089, .0046, .0024, .0012, 6.1e-4, 3.1e-4, 1.6e-4, 8e-5}; /* System generated locals */ PetscInt i__1; double d__1, d__2, d__3, d__4; /* Local variables */ static double emin, emax; static PetscInt dsgn[6]; static double f_max, f_min, stdv; static PetscInt i__, j; static double scale; static PetscInt mh; static PetscInt cancel[6], dnoise; static double err2, est1, est2, est3, est4; /* ********** */ /* Subroutine dnest */ /* This subroutine estimates the noise in a function */ /* and provides estimates of the optimal difference parameter */ /* for a forward-difference approximation. */ /* The user must provide a difference parameter h, and the */ /* function value at nf points centered around the current point. */ /* For example, if nf = 7, the user must provide */ /* f(x-2*h), f(x-h), f(x), f(x+h), f(x+2*h), */ /* in the array fval. The use of nf = 7 function evaluations is */ /* recommended. */ /* The noise in the function is roughly defined as the variance in */ /* the computed value of the function. The noise in the function */ /* provides valuable information. For example, function values */ /* smaller than the noise should be considered to be zero. */ /* This subroutine requires an initial estimate for h. Under estimates */ /* are usually preferred. If noise is not detected, the user should */ /* increase or decrease h according to the output value of info. */ /* In most cases, the subroutine detects noise with the initial */ /* value of h. */ /* The subroutine statement is */ /* subroutine dnest(nf,fval,h,hopt,fnoise,info,eps) */ /* where */ /* nf is a PetscInt variable. */ /* On entry nf is the number of function values. */ /* On exit nf is unchanged. */ /* f is a double precision array of dimension nf. */ /* On entry f contains the function values. */ /* On exit f is overwritten. */ /* h is a double precision variable. */ /* On entry h is an estimate of the optimal difference parameter. */ /* On exit h is unchanged. */ /* fnoise is a double precision variable. */ /* On entry fnoise need not be specified. */ /* On exit fnoise is set to an estimate of the function noise */ /* if noise is detected; otherwise fnoise is set to zero. */ /* hopt is a double precision variable. */ /* On entry hopt need not be specified. */ /* On exit hopt is set to an estimate of the optimal difference */ /* parameter if noise is detected; otherwise hopt is set to zero. */ /* info is a PetscInt variable. */ /* On entry info need not be specified. */ /* On exit info is set as follows: */ /* info = 1 Noise has been detected. */ /* info = 2 Noise has not been detected; h is too small. */ /* Try 100*h for the next value of h. */ /* info = 3 Noise has not been detected; h is too large. */ /* Try h/100 for the next value of h. */ /* info = 4 Noise has been detected but the estimate of hopt */ /* is not reliable; h is too small. */ /* eps is a double precision work array of dimension nf. */ /* MINPACK-2 Project.
